Abstract :
The aim of speech stream detection is to capture the speech stream which comes randomly. HOS have inherent properties that make them well suited when dealing with a mixture of Gaussian and non-Gaussian processes. One and half spectrum is a special case of HOS; it not only holds the characters but also saves a lot of computing time. This paper explores the one and half spectrum of speech signal and presents a new algorithm for speech stream detection. The results of a lot of experiments, whose data come from the real recorded on spot, show that the method is performed well.
